MM#009 Default Target
Dear Collaborators,
Target region NOAA 2773 produced two minor A-class events since the last message. The largest was an A7.0 at 09/28/02:54 UT. 2773 is currently displaying at few pores. There is a tiny EFR with a two spot B-type/beta sunspot group located at S21W03. No significant solar flare events expected in the next 24 hour period.
The position of NOAA 2773 on September 28 at 17:30 UT is: N27W02 (Solar X =030", Solar Y = 332")
